介绍
搭建一个vuepress博客有何优点
# 初衷
早就听说了vuepress,当初的契机是想着选一款好用的在线文档工具,后来看到很多技术的docs都是样式比较类似,我就下意识的猜想肯定是使用了一种专门的解决方案,果不其然,后来就顺藤摸瓜找到了vuepress了。
# 转折
前几天一次偶然的机会,我发现了一个好看的vuepress的博客主题,才让我坚定的搭建一个vuepress静态博客,这个博客主题就是 vuepress-theme-reco,很感谢作者,非常用心,我也在作者的基础上对这个主题稍加修改,站在巨人的肩膀上,最终搭建了本博客。
# 搭建
看到vuepress的官方文档,刚开始有点懵,其实如果做一个cli的话会好很多,后来是通过查看一些博客才起步的,不过现在的官网文档好了很多,介绍的很详细,每一个文件的路径和作用,以及配置项都说的很详细。
# 迁移
为啥要打造一个博客的备用站,事实上,我现在已经有了一个基于nuxt.js和spring boot搭建的博客了,这个博客是学习大于博客实际用处,我心目中的想法是,博客不需要那么多的后台交互,完全可以静态化,静态化的博客,部署更方便,seo更好,事实上比nuxt的seo更好,毕竟是全静态的,而且使用cdn加速更能立竿见影。 其实使用静态博客的好处有以下几点
- 节省带宽和减少cpu的压力。
- cdn加速更能立竿见影。
- 维护方便,只需要管理静态文档就好,一次开发完毕,专注写作。
- 迁移平滑,目前有很多的静态博客网站。
- 未来考虑使用serveless函数计算来部署站点。
- 阿里云续费太贵,过期后不打算再续了。
# 后记
当然,使用nuxt.js的服务端渲染来开发前后端分离的博客不香吗?当然香,扩展很方便,想要什么功能就有什么功能,但是我总觉得太重了,而且很多功能我不是很追求,直需要简单的写作加上评论就够了,所以我还是想给自己打造一个vuepress的博客,目前当作备用站。
主站在这里 zealsay博客